How to Create an Effective Email Marketing Campaign with MailChimp

Creating an effective email marketing campaign with MailChimp can be a great way to reach your target audience and increase your sales. Here are some tips to help you get started:

1. Set Up Your Account: Before you can start creating your email campaigns, you’ll need to set up a MailChimp account. This is free and easy to do, and will give you access to all of the features that MailChimp has to offer.

2. Create Your List: Once you have your account set up, it’s time to create your list of contacts. You can add contacts manually or import them from other sources such as a CSV file or an existing email list. Make sure that all of the contact information is accurate and up-to-date before sending out any emails.

3. Design Your Email Template: Now it’s time to design the look and feel of your emails. MailChimp offers a variety of templates that you can customize with images, text, and colors that match your brand identity. You can also use HTML code if you want more control over the design of your emails.

4. Write Your Content: Once you have designed the look of your emails, it’s time to write the content for them. Make sure that each email contains relevant information about your products or services, as well as any special offers or discounts that you may be offering at the time. Keep in mind that people are more likely to open emails if they contain interesting content rather than just sales pitches.

5. Test & Send: Before sending out any emails, make sure to test them first by sending them out to yourself or a few trusted contacts first so that you can make sure everything looks right and works properly before sending it out to everyone else on your list. Once everything looks good, hit send!

6. Track & Analyze Results: After sending out your emails, it’s important to track their performance so that you can see how successful they were in reaching their intended audience and achieving their desired results (e.g., increased sales). MailChimp provides detailed analytics on each campaign so that you can track open rates, click-through rates, unsubscribes, etc., which will help inform future campaigns and ensure maximum success for each one going forward!

How to Optimize Your MailChimp Email Templates for Maximum Engagement

1. Use a Responsive Design: Make sure your email template is optimized for mobile devices. This will ensure that your emails look great on any device, and make it easier for readers to engage with your content.

2. Keep Your Content Concise: Keep your emails short and to the point. Long emails can be overwhelming and may cause readers to lose interest quickly.

3. Include a Clear Call-to-Action: Make sure you include a clear call-to-action in each email, such as “Click Here” or “Sign Up Now”. This will help encourage readers to take action and engage with your content.

4. Personalize Your Content: Personalize your emails by including the reader’s name or other relevant information in the subject line or body of the email. This will help make the reader feel more connected to your message and increase engagement levels.

5. Utilize A/B Testing: Use A/B testing to determine which elements of your email are most effective at driving engagement levels, such as subject lines, images, or calls-to-action. This will help you optimize future emails for maximum engagement levels.

6. Monitor Your Results: Monitor the results of each email campaign to determine which elements are working best and which need improvement. This will help you refine future campaigns for maximum engagement levels over time.

Tips and Tricks for Automating Your MailChimp Email Marketing Processes

1. Utilize Automation Rules: Automation rules allow you to set up automated emails that are triggered by certain actions taken by your subscribers. This can help you save time and ensure that your emails are sent out at the right time.

2. Create Segmented Lists: Segmenting your lists allows you to send more targeted emails to specific groups of people. This can help you increase engagement and ensure that your messages are reaching the right people.

3. Use Templates: Templates can help you save time when creating emails, as they provide a starting point for your design and content. You can also use templates to create a consistent look and feel for all of your emails.

4. Schedule Your Emails: Scheduling your emails allows you to plan ahead and ensure that they are sent out at the right time. You can also use scheduling to stagger the delivery of multiple emails, which can help increase engagement with each message.

5. Monitor Performance: Monitoring the performance of your campaigns is essential for understanding how effective they are and what changes need to be made in order to improve them in the future. MailChimp provides detailed analytics that allow you to track open rates, click-through rates, and more.

6. Test Your Emails: Testing is an important part of any email marketing process, as it allows you to identify any issues before sending out a campaign. MailChimp provides tools such as A/B testing which allow you to compare different versions of an email in order to determine which one performs better with your audience.
